Manipur Raj Bhawan Bombing Case: 2 convicted by Special NIA Court

Guwahati: Two defendants were found guilty in a grenade attack on the Manipur Raj Bhawan on January 19, 2021 by a special National Investigation Agency (NIA) court in Imphal.

The court also stated that it would hear the two convicted parties’ sentences and issue a ruling on July 16.

The two convicts in question, Lisham Ibosana alias Micheal, aged 42 years is from Khongman Lisham and Konsam Manithoi, aged 46 years is from Lairikyengbam Leikai.

The court had earlier remanded them to judicial custody till July 12.

It may be noted that on March 5, 2021, a FIR was filed in the case at the Imphal City Police Station.

The bombing case was re-registered on March 6, 2021 at the NIA branch office in New Delhi under sections 16 (1)(b) and 20 of the Unlawful Activities (Prevention) Act, section 4 of the Explosive Substances Act, and section 307 of the Indian Penal Code (IPC).

The two convicted individuals were charged with violations of sections 307/120 B of the IPC, as well as sections 16, 18, 20, and 38 of the UAPA and section 4 of the explosive substance act.
